We recently had the chance to chat again with Brett Dier about his character of Luke Matheson on ABC Family’s hit new drama series Ravenswood.
In our latest conference call, Brett reveals to us what fans can expect when Ravenswood returns this January. Among the tidbits he let slip, he teases what’s ahead for Luke and Remy’s relationship and just what will have Luke in handcuffs!
Ravenswood returns with season 1b on Tuesday, January 7th at 9/8c on ABC Family.

Will Luke be handling his own investigating – aside from the group – in order to find out what happened to his father?
Brett Dier: Yes, there will definitely be some of that. Luke also gets in some trouble with the law, he gets to go in the back of a cop car. He’s definitely more involved than in the first half of the season, where he was to himself and didn’t believe in anything. He’s definitely doing some investigating by himself, with Remy and with his sister. There’s even a cool couple of scenes with Luke and Caleb now, so there’s some bromance going on.
Is there any hope for Luke and Remy’s relationship in the second half of the season?
Brett Dier: They are definitely figuring things out and they are a lot better than how they were. There’s still obviously a little bit of issues but they are working things out.
Are there any pieces about the next five episodes you can share with us today?
Brett: I mentioned Luke is in a cop car. I mentioned that you get to see how Remy sleepwalks, you get to see her actual dream sequences, which are actually sweet, so that’s a big thing. You pretty much find out a lot of the questions that people have, like who made the curse, you find that out. You find out a lot of things.
